Curiosity
Individuals who score high in curiosity tend to take an interest in ongoing experience for its own sake. They find a large number of topics and subjects fascinating, and they enjoy activities that provide avenues for explorations and discoveries.
Judgment
People who score high in judgment exercise prudence in regard to their important decisions. They think things through and examine situations from all sides, as they dislike jumping to conclusions. They tend to change their minds in light of evidence, weighing the pros and cons fairly.
Love of Learning
Individuals who score high in this strength enjoy mastering new skills, topics, and bodies of knowledge. Love of learning is related to curiosity but goes beyond it, as it also describes the tendency to add systematically to what one knows, be it formally or informally.
Perspective
People who score high in perspective are able to provide wise counsel to others; they have ways of looking at the world that make deep sense to themselves as well as to others. This is related to the strength of judgment; however, perspective focuses on having particular and various attitudes toward different kinds of situations.
Bravery
Individuals who score high in this dimension tend to not shrink from threat, challenge, difficulty, or pain. They speak up for what’s right even if there’s opposition, and they tend to act on their convictions even if they are unpopular. For instance, they speak up in protest when they hear someone say mean things. This strength includes physical bravery but is not limited to it.
Perseverance
People who score high in perseverance finish what they start despite obstacles. They take pleasure in completing tasks and seldom quit a task before it is done. With their persistence, they are motivated to be productive and get things done.
Honesty
People who score high in this dimension tend to speak the truth and keep their promises. They usually present themselves in a genuine way and act with sincerity. Being without pretense, they take responsibility for their feelings and actions.
Zest
People who are zestful approach life with excitement and energy. As a result, they do not do things halfway or halfheartedly. They live their lives as adventures and feel alive and activated. For instance, they tend to be excited by many different activities and are genuinely excited to start each day.
Love
Individuals who score high in this dimension tend to value close relations with others, in particular those in which sharing and caring are reciprocated. They are often close to people and healthily communicate, receive, and reciprocate affection.
Kindness
Kind people enjoy doing favors and good deeds for others. They are happy to help and are known for taking good care of others. Moreover, they tend to be considerate, friendly, generous, and warmhearted. They are often described as gentle and patient as they tend to go out of their way to help others, offer a listening ear, and give encouragement.
Social Intelligence
Socially intelligent individuals tend to be aware of the motives and feelings of others, including themselves. They know what to do to fit into different social situations and know what makes other people tick. They are good at sensing what other people may be going through and have excellent clues on what to say to make others feel better.
Teamwork
People who score high in teamwork work well as a member of a group. They are good collaborators and are responsible in accomplishing the tasks assigned to them. They tend to be loyal and supportive of the groups they participate in; they do their best to come up with a collective output.
Fairness
Individuals who score high in this dimension tend to treat all people the same, in accordance with notions of fairness and justice. The do not let their feelings bias their decisions about others and they try their best to give everyone a fair chance.
Leadership
Good leaders encourage their group to get things done and, at the same time, maintain good relations within the group. Those who score high in this dimension tend to organize group activities and see to it that they happen. Hence, people usually turn to them to lead organizations.
Forgiveness
Forgiving people accept the shortcomings of others and are not vengeful. People who score high in this dimension tend to give others a second chance and exonerate those who have done wrong. They can easily let go of negative feelings such as resentment, anger, and vengeance.
Humility
Humble individuals let their accomplishments speak for themselves. They do not regard themselves as more special than what they really are. For instance, they prefer to let other people talk about them and are usually meek about the good things that have happened to them.
Prudence
Prudent individuals are careful about their choices. They do not take undue risks and do not say or do things that might later be regretted. They tend to be very cautious as they always think through the consequences before they act and think before they speak.
Self-Regulation
People who score high on this dimension regulate what they feel and do. They tend to be disciplined and are able to control their appetites and emotions. For instance, they do not easily give in to temptation, and they do not engage in things that are bad for them in the long run, even if such experiences make them feel good in the short run.
Appreciation of Beauty
Individuals who score high on this dimension notice and appreciate beauty, excellence, and/or skilled performance in various domains of life, from nature and art to mathematics and science and to everyday experience. Hence, they tend to think that life is interesting, as they are usually aware of the natural beauty in the environment and in various experiences that others do not notice.
Gratitude
Grateful people are aware of the good things that happen as they have a profound sense of appreciation. They also take time to express thanks and acknowledge the various forms of blessings in their lives. Thus, when they feel down, they tend to think of the brighter side of their experiences.
Hope
People who score high on this dimension tend to expect the best in the future and work to achieve it. They have feelings of expectation, and they desire for certain goals to happen. They believe that good things can be brought about.
Humor
Individuals who have a good sense of humor like to laugh, make (not necessarily tell) jokes, and tease. They tend to bring smiles to other people and see the lighter side of things. Hence, they do not allow gloomy situations to take away their joy.
Spirituality
People who score high in this dimension have coherent beliefs about the higher purpose and meaning of the universe. They know where they fit within the larger scheme and have convictions about the meaning of life that shape their conduct and provide them with comfort.
